In aerial application operations, high temperatures have a significant impact on fuel consumption. As temperatures rise, fuel becomes less dense, which can lead to increased fuel consumption for the aircraft. This is particularly vital for aerial applicators to consider, as optimizing fuel efficiency can affect the overall economy and effectiveness of the operations.

While high temperatures may also influence other factors such as lift capacity and flight speed, the most direct manner in which operations are typically affected is through increased fuel consumption. Aircraft engines may need to work harder to maintain performance in hotter air, which can lead to greater fuel use. Understanding how heat affects fuel efficiency is crucial for aerial applicators when planning flight operations in varying temperature conditions.

Adjustments to flight plans, payloads, and operational strategies may be required to accommodate the changing dynamics of aircraft performance under high-temperature scenarios to ensure both safety and efficiency.
